How Our Warehouse Water Damage Restoration Process Works
When you call our team, you can expect a thorough and efficient process that gets your warehouse back to normal quickly. Here’s what you can expect:
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our team will arrive on site and conduct a thorough assessment of the damage. We’ll identify the source of the water, assess the extent of the damage, and provide you with a detailed report and estimate.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use our advanced equipment to extract the standing water from your warehouse, including our powerful pumps and wet vacuums.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your warehouse, including air movers and dehumidifiers, to prevent further damage and ensure your property is safe and healthy.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ize your warehouse to remove any remaining moisture, bacteria, and contaminants.
Step 5: Reconstruction and Repair
Our team will work with you to repair and rebuild any damaged areas, including drywall, flooring, and ceilings.

Warning Signs You Need Warehouse Water Damage Restoration
Don’t wait until you have a major disaster on your hands, catch these warning signs early to prevent costly repairs and potential health risks.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old and mildew, which can be hazardous to your health. If you notice persistent musty smells in your warehouse, it’s time to call our team.
Water Stains and Discoloration
Water stains and discoloration can show water damage and potential structural issues. If you notice any unusual stains or discoloration on your walls, floors, or ceilings, don’t ignore it, call our team.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age and potential structural issues. If you notice any unusual warping or buckling on your floors, it’s time to call our team.
Visible Signs of Leaks or Water Damage
Visible signs of leaks or water damage, such as water pooling, mineral deposits, or rust, can show a serious issue. If you notice any of these signs, don’t wait, call our team.
Unusual Noises or Sounds
Unusual noises or sounds, such as creaking, groaning, or hissing, can show water damage and potential structural issues. If you notice any unusual noises or sounds, it’s time to call our team.
Changes in Temperature or Humidity
Changes in temperature or humidity can show water damage and potential structural issues. If you notice any unusual changes in temperature or humidity in your warehouse, don’t ignore it, call our team.

Q: What is the best way to prevent water damage in a warehouse?
A: The best way to prevent water damage in a warehouse is to regularly inspect and maintain your plumbing, HVAC, and roof systems. Also, consider installing flood-control measures such as flood-proof doors and flood-control valves.
